StealthWorker Brute-force Malware Attack on Windows & Linux Platform

Stealthy malware written in Golang language already being used by Mirai botnet develop module. E-commerce websites are being compromised by attackers using an embedded skimmer, before that they gain access to their targets backend. Previous version of this malware only targeted the windows platform but this new version also serves payload binaries to compromised the Linux platform. During the execution of StealthWorker malware, the malware creates a scheduled execution to make sure the malware stay persist even after victims reboot the system.”]
